Getting around Nassau/Paradise Island

Some of the major car hire companies can be found at Nassau Airport or downtown Nassau; car hire arrangements can be made with companies in the UK before you travel. Local buses (jitneys) are frequent during the day and an interesting way to see the sights of Nassau. Horse-drawn carriages can be hired for historical tours of Nassau. Taxis are plentiful throughout the island and prices are fixed from point to point. See the table below for taxi fares*:

Transfer from Nassau International airport to Paradise Island

$20

Transfer from Nassau International airport to Cable Beach

$12

Cable Beach to downtown

$10

A 5 mile taxi ride

$10

Other options to consider for exploring Nassau are scooter and bicycle hire.
